#204c02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#204c02 is composed of 12.5% red, 29.8%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.4% yellow and 70.2% black. It has a hue angle of 95.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 15.3%. #204c02 color hex could be obtained by blending #409804 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#204c02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#204c02 has RGB values of R:32, G:76,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.7. Its decimal value is 2116610.
